Hi everybody,
My native language is Farsi/Persian but unfortunately blackberry hasn't provide keyboard language for it yet.
As a matter of fact, Arabic language is similar to Persian language with difference in only 4 characters, and blackberry supports Arabic keyboard language, so I don't think there is a lot of work to be done to provide Persian keyboard language.
Anyway, I decided to define my own keyboard language for Persian, but I don't know if this can be done by a third party or not? If it does, how?

Please help me

I forgot to mention that my device is bold 9900.
